What you need to know about Baram

Set along the Baram River in northern Sarawak, the district has a slow-paced, riverine character that shapes steady local demand for homes: families and community members prioritize proximity to longhouse settlements and small town centres rather than urban conveniences. Buyers and renters will find a mix of traditional longhouses and kampung-style detached homes, with modest terrace houses and shophouses in Marudi and other small towns serving daily needs. Road links to larger cities can be long and services are basic beyond town clinics, primary schools and local markets, so access to specialist healthcare or higher education usually means travel to larger urban centres. The property market is modest and local-driven, with limited new development and mainly practical appeal for those seeking rural living or community ties rather than fast capital appreciation.
